Tungsten carbide (WC) wear plates and flanges significantly improve the productivity of High-Pressure Grinding Rolls (HPGR) by enhancing durability, reducing downtime, and optimizing grinding efficiency. Here’s how they contribute:

1. Extreme Wear Resistance
- Tungsten carbide is one of the hardest materials available (HV 1500-2000), far surpassing steel in abrasion resistance.
- HPGRs operate under high pressure (50-300 MPa), causing severe wear on rolls and flanges. WC wear plates protect critical surfaces, extending service life by 3-5 times compared to traditional steel components.
2. Reduced Downtime & Maintenance Costs
- WC-lined flanges and wear plates minimize frequent replacements, reducing unplanned shutdowns.
- Fewer maintenance intervals mean higher operational availability, crucial for continuous mining and mineral processing.
3. Consistent Grinding Performance
- Worn flanges and plates lead to uneven roll gaps, reducing grinding efficiency.
- Tungsten carbide maintains its shape longer, ensuring stable pressure distribution and consistent product size distribution.

4. Improved Energy Efficiency
- WC’s low friction coefficient reduces energy losses due to slippage.
- Efficient grinding with less wear means lower specific energy consumption (kWh/ton)—key for cost savings in HPGR operations.
5. Protection Against Edge Wear & Spillage
- The flange area is prone to edge wear, leading to material spillage and roll damage.
- WC-reinforced flanges prevent premature edge degradation, maintaining sealing integrity and reducing material bypass.
6. Compatibility with Aggressive Materials
- Ideal for processing highly abrasive ores (e.g., iron, gold, diamond, and copper), where steel components fail quickly.
